Home i-mobile Phones i-mobile S385 i-mobile S385 Specs No User reviews yet i-mobile S385 User reviews Not announced No information Display 2.4 inches 320 x 240 pixels Camera 2 MP (Single camera) Storage , microSD Battery 1400 mAh Description The i-mobile S385 is a dual SIM phone with a 2.4-inch touchscreen display, 2-megapixel camera, full QWERTY keyboard, microSD card slot and TV tuner.
